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/2 cup water
- 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/4 cup granulated sugar
- 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1 large egg
- Cooking spray
Instructions
- In a saucepan, combine water, butter, and a pinch of salt. Bring to a boil.
- Remove from heat and stir in flour until a dough forms.
- Let the dough cool slightly, then beat in the egg and vanilla until smooth.
- Preheat the air fryer to 375°F (190°C). Spray the basket with cooking spray.
- Spoon the dough into a piping bag with a star tip or shape into small ropes.
- Pipe or shape small bites onto a parchment-lined tray.
- Place in the air fryer and cook for 8-10 minutes until golden and crispy.
- Mix sugar and cinnamon in a bowl. Toss the warm churro bites in the cinnamon sugar mixture.
- Serve warm with chocolate sauce or your favorite topping.
Notes
- Ensure the dough is soft but manageable for piping.
- Adjust cooking time for larger or smaller bites.
- Use a non-stick spray for easy removal.
